Interview with the 2002 Laureates in Economics, Daniel Kahneman and Vernon L. Smith

Daniel Kahneman and Vernon Smith ()

No 2002-5, Nobel Prize in Economics documents from Nobel Prize Committee

Abstract: Interview with the 2002 Laureates in Economics, Daniel Kahneman and Vernon L. Smith, December 12, 2002. Interviewers are Professor Karl-Gustaf Loefgren and Dr Anne-Sophie Crepin.
